To appreciate just how narrow, you have only to look at Venus. Venus 1s only ©10 15 twenty-five million miles closer to the Sun than we are. The Sun's warmth reaches it just two minutes before it touches us. In size and composition, Venus is very like Earth, but the small difference in orbital distance made all the difference to (3)how it turned out. It appears that during the early years of the solar system Venus was only slightly warmer than Earth and probably had oceans. But those few degrees of extra 20 warmth meant that Venus could not hold on to its surface water, with disastrous consequences for its climate. As its water evaporated, the hydrogen atoms escaped into space, and the oxygen atoms combined with carbon to form a dense atmosphere of the greenhouse gas CO2. Venus became stifling. Although people of my age will recall a time when astrononmers hoped that Venus might harbor life beneath its padded 25 clouds, possibly even a kind of tropical vegetation, we now know that it is much too fierce an environment for any kind of life that we can reasonably conceive of.
